'Stud' Ted Cruz wins CPAC straw poll (and is in great shape elsewhere)

Sen. Ted Cruz easily won the CPAC 2016 straw poll, beating second-place finisher Marco Rubio by a wide margin and more than doubling Donald Trump’s vote count.

Fifteen percent really isn’t bad, considering that Trump canceled his appearance at CPAC at the last minute to campaign in Kansas.

Speaking of Kansas, early returns there and in Maine suggest that Cruz is going to have a very good day today when races are called.
